In 2015, Lakeview Ford’s service department provided professional warranty repairs on my 2013 Ford F-350 truck. In December 2017, the air bag status light within the instrument panel display cluster remained on. Normally, that light should shut off. So, I had Lakeview Ford’s service department analyze the problem. It was determined my truck needed a CLOCK SPRING. Who would have thought a truck has a clock spring? My service advisor was Steve Schneider. He did a great job submitting the needed repairs through Ford as a warranty claim-Ford covered the part and labor. It seems that Ford’s Supplemental Restraint System (SRS), is covered for 5 years or 60,000 miles. But, I didn’t know that. So, even though my original Ford bumper to bumper warranty had expired, Steve went the extra mile and saved me money. That’s excellent customer service! Many thanks to Lakeview Ford’s Steve Schneider and the service department personnel!
